Overview:Serve as a strategic consultant between HR Centers of Excellence and the business. Understand the business, interpret their needs, and advise business unit leaders on appropriate people strategies.
Responsibilities:1. Maximize the development of internal talent through regular performance coaching, performance reviews, and presenting development opportunities.
2. Collaborate with business unit leaders to integrate people & culture strategies into the overall business unit strategy and operating plan, ensuring Human Resources standards are present, proactive and predictive.
3. Guide and support organizational change initiatives ensuring people strategies are in place to support successful execution and adoption.
4. Consult on initiatives to optimize organizational design and structure to enhance efficiency, scalability, and responsiveness to business needs.
5. Coach leaders on complex performance issues, talent decisions, and leadership effectiveness, ensuring a culture of accountability aligned with Sheetz culture and DNA. Ensure leaders have adopted a consistent approach to performance management and help drive the execution of the biannual performance management process.
6. Partner with HR COEs to drive adoption and execution of the workforce planning process to align with the organization's growth projections, market trends, and talent availability, proactively addressing skill gaps and succession needs.
7. Partner with Human Resource Centers of Excellence and business unit leaders to identify, hire, develop and place high-potential leaders ensuring robust succession plans for critical roles.
8. Work with Human Resource Centers of Excellence and business unit leaders to drive the desired leadership behaviors and cultural attributes that drive performance, innovation, and employee engagement at the leadership level and below. Coach leaders to ensure they model the behaviors individually and as a leadership team.
9. Provide critical, strategic input to Human Resource Centers of Excellence to ensure programs and services meet the unique, evolving needs of the business. Collaborate with Centers of Excellence to design solutions to meet business need challenges.
10. Act as a sponsor and champion for key HR initiatives (e.g., compensation reviews, benefits changes, HRIS implementations) within the business unit, ensuring buy-in and successful adoption by leaders.
11. Identify opportunities to streamline and enhance metrics and HR processes working with HR Centers of Excellence to improve efficiency and user experience.
12. Partner with stakeholders to mitigate risk across the regional footprint, including proactively addressing potential issues, ensuring fair labor practices, and connecting internal experts in Government Relations, Employee Relations, Legal, and PR to enable a positive work culture.
